an enormous array of
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"an enormous array of"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a large and diverse collection of items, options, or elements in various contexts. Example: "The museum features an enormous array of artifacts from ancient civilizations."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"an enormous array of", ensure the context clearly indicates that the items being described are diverse in nature. This phrase is best suited when highlighting variety, not just quantity.
Common error
Avoid using "an enormous array of" when "a large number of" or "many" would suffice. The phrase is more effective when emphasizing diversity and variety, not just a high quantity of similar items.

FAQs
How can I use "an enormous array of" in a sentence?
Use "an enormous array of" to describe a large and diverse collection of items. For example: "The conference presented an enormous array of research topics."
What are some alternatives to "an enormous array of"?
You can use alternatives like "a vast assortment of", "a wide selection of", or "a diverse collection of" depending on the specific context.
Is it more appropriate to use "an enormous range of" or "an enormous array of"?
"An enormous range of" is best when referring to a continuous spectrum or scale, while "an enormous array of" is better for describing a diverse collection of distinct items. For instance, "an enormous range of colors" vs. "an enormous array of dishes".
What does "an enormous array of" emphasize in a description?
The phrase "an enormous array of" emphasizes both the size and diversity of the collection. It suggests not only a large quantity but also a wide variety of different elements or options.
